dc.description.abstract This paper presents the design concept, models, and open-loop control of a particular form of a variablereluctance spherical motor (VRSM), referred here as a spherical wheel motor (SWM). Unlike existing spherical motors where design focuses have been on controlling the three degrees of freedom (DOF) angular displacements, the SWM offers a means to control the orientation of a continuously rotating shaft in an open-loop (OL) fashion. We provide a formula for deriving different switching sequences (full step and fractional step) for a specified current magnitude and pole configurations. The concept feasibility of an OL controlled SWM has been experimentally demonstrated on a prototype that has 8 rotor permanent-magnet (PM) pole-pairs and 10 stator electromagnet (EM) pole-pairs. -
